Wem's very own Greg Davies will be coming back to his hometown to turn on its Christmas Lights this year.
The comedian and actor, as well as the titular 'Taskmaster' on the Dave TV series, will be on hand to switch the lights on in Wem on Friday, December 6.
He has often spoke of his upbringing in north Shropshire in much of his stand-up, and drew on his experiences of his former life as a teacher in his hit Channel 4 series Man Down.
Greg will be the star attraction at the Victorian-themed festival, but there will be street stalls, craft stalls, festive music, lantern parade, Wem Rotary Santa and Sleigh, Shrewsbury’s Town Crier, Reindeer with sleigh, the Wem Snow Queen, among others.
Organisers of the switch-on have also appealed for more outdoor stallholders, costing £15 a pitch and space for a generator and gazebo (not provided).
